Description:
Image 1 is the starting screen, I have used colors to represent apps, as bright colors and big fonts are helpful for the visually impaired. The right side displays open apps to keep track of any apps that are currently running. At this point there are none, so it is empty.
Image 2 shows, when the mouse is moved onto an app (hover) it is magnified along with the name of the app.
Image 3 shows App 4 opened, and the corresponding color displayed on the right.
Image 4 shows app 1 opened and the corresponding color displayed on the right. Red is below yellow as yellow was opened first and then minimized.
Image 5 shows the starting screen again along with the minimized apps on the right side.
What each app contains is not important at this stage. Working UI is more important.
